You are trying waaaaaaaaay to hard to find a correlation between cartridges used and distance an animal may run.
There is no correlation.
Take a .223 Remington and a 300 Win mag. Despite the difference in power and bullet weight and diameter you could shoot 10 different deer with each cartridge and get 10 entirely different results for each. With either cartridge some deer may run 200 yards, some may drop in their tracks, some may trot off and look back at you and just fall over.
Assuming the cartridge you are using is adequate for the game being hunted there is no correlation at all.
